1. Sheer Volume of Dots: This is often the most immediate indicator of an "extreme" puzzle. While a children's dot-to-dot might have 50-100 dots, extreme versions regularly boast 500, 1000, 2000, or even 5000+ dots. The sheer number transforms the experience from a quick sketch into a marathon artistic endeavor. *I once embarked on a 1500-dot puzzle featuring a complex city skyline, and the feeling of accomplishment when the final skyscraper emerged was unparalleled. It was a true test of endurance and patience!*

2. Intricate Detail & Fine Lines: With more dots comes the ability to render incredibly fine details. We're talking about shading, textures, subtle curves, and the nuanced expressions of a portrait. The finished image isn't just an outline; it's a fully realized piece of art. This level of detail keeps you guessing and engaged, as each cluster of dots reveals another layer of the hidden picture.

3. Complex Numbering Systems: Some extreme puzzles introduce twists to the numbering. It might not always be a straightforward 1-2-3 sequence. You might encounter:

  • Multiple Sequences: Several sets of numbers (e.g., 1-100, then A-Z, then Roman numerals) that create different layers or elements of the image.
  • Skip-Counting: Connecting dots by 2s, 3s, or even more complex patterns, adding a mathematical challenge.
  • Hidden Paths: Dots that seem out of sequence but are part of a smaller, internal detail that only connects after a certain point.

4. Large Format & Print Size: To accommodate the multitude of dots and intricate details, extreme connect the dots are often designed for larger print sizes, such as A3 or even poster-sized. This enhances the visual impact and prevents eye strain, making the grand scale of the project feel even more impressive. Printing these behemoths is a project in itself!

1. Prepare Your Workspace:

  • Good Lighting is Key: This isn't optional. Eye strain is a real danger with intricate puzzles. Ensure you have ample, even lighting, preferably natural light supplemented by a good desk lamp.
  • Clear, Flat Surface: A sturdy, uncluttered surface is crucial for comfortable drawing. You don't want your paper sliding around or your elbow bumping into things.
  • Comfortable Seating: You'll be spending a significant amount of time on this, so invest in an ergonomic chair or at least one that offers good back support. Your posture will thank you.

2. Gather the Right Tools (and Keep Them Organized!):

  • Sharpened Pencils (Multiple!): Mechanical pencils (0.5mm or 0.7mm) are often preferred for their consistent fine line, but a good old-fashioned graphite pencil (HB or 2B) with a sharpener works too. Have several on hand to avoid interruptions.
  • Quality Eraser: Mistakes happen! A good quality white vinyl or kneaded eraser will remove pencil marks cleanly without damaging the paper.
  • Ruler (Optional but Recommended): For very long, straight lines, a ruler can ensure precision. For most extreme puzzles, the lines are curved, so a ruler is less critical but still handy for certain sections.
  • Magnifying Glass (for the truly extreme): For puzzles with incredibly tiny dots or numbers, a simple magnifying glass or even reading glasses can be a lifesaver.

3. The "Find Your Bearings" Scan:

  • Before drawing a single line, take a moment to scan the entire page. Get a general feel for the distribution of dots. Are they clustered in certain areas? Are there large empty spaces? This initial overview helps you mentally prepare.
  • Locate '1'. It's your starting point, your anchor in the storm of numbers.
